Defining Mean Corpuscular Volume (MCV)

Doctors use Mean Corpuscular Volume, or MCV, to check cell size. A healthy MCV is between 80 and 100 femtoliters.

If MCV is over 100 femtoliters, it means you have macrocytosis. Knowing this helps doctors see if your bone marrow is working right. It’s key to checking your blood health.

Statistical Overview of Macrocytosis in the General Population

Macrocytosis affects about 2 to 4 percent of the general population. This may seem small, but it’s a big number of people seeking medical help. It is important to remember that these findings are often manageable when caught early.

How Alcohol Consumption Impacts Bone Marrow Function

Alcohol is a strong toxin that harms your bone marrow. This tissue makes your blood cells, keeping your body working. When alcohol gets into your blood, it affects more than just your liver or brain. It goes deep into the marrow, messing with how blood cells are made.

Direct Toxic Effects of Ethanol on Hematopoiesis

Hematopoiesis is how stem cells turn into blood cells. Drinking alcohol often makes this process hard. Alcohol can mess with the DNA of these cells, causing them to grow too big.

We see that alcohol’s toxic effects often make cells bigger than they should be before they enter your blood. These enlarged red blood cells from drinking show that your bone marrow is struggling. Malabsorption and Storage Issues in Chronic Alcoholism

The damage from alcohol consumption and vitamin B12 deficiency mainly affects the digestive tract and liver. The liver stores B12, and vitamin B12 alcoholism reduces its ability to do so. This means alcoholics and vitamin B12 deficiency often go together, as the liver can’t store or release B12 well.

Also, how does alcohol cause vitamin B12 deficiency? It irritates the stomach and reduces intrinsic factor production, needed for absorption. We stress the importance of monitoring b12 alcohol interactions with blood tests. Checking B12 and folate levels helps diagnose and treat better.

Differential Diagnosis in Clinical Practice

We use a detailed method to figure out the cause. This includes lab tests and looking at the patient’s history. We check liver and nutrition tests, along with a full blood count.

The table below shows how we tell these conditions apart:

ConditionPrimary CauseKey Diagnostic Marker
Alcohol-InducedEthanol ToxicityElevated GGT Levels
Folate DeficiencyNutritional LackLow Serum Folate
B12 DeficiencyMalabsorptionLow Vitamin B12

By looking at these markers, we can find out if macrocytosis alcohol is the main issue. Or if other health problems are also involved. This careful approach makes sure our patients get the best care. We always explain why we need to run many tests to find the right diagnosis.

Understanding the 100 Femtoliter Threshold

The Mean Corpuscular Volume (MCV) is a key measure in blood cell size. If your red blood cells are bigger than 100 femtoliters (fL), it’s called macrocytosis. Doctors use this number to check for possible health issues, like drinking too much alcohol.

An MCV over 100 fL is a sign, not a diagnosis. It tells doctors to look into your body’s health more closely. Early detection helps your body heal faster.

Why Months of Abstinence Are Required for Normalization

Your bone marrow needs time to fully recover from alcohol’s effects. It takes about 120 days for red blood cells to live and get replaced. Patience is essential during this time.

Short breaks can’t undo long-term alcohol damage. Long-term abstinence lets your body clear out toxins. Below is a table showing the stages of recovery seen in clinics.

Recovery PhaseTimelineExpected Hematological Change
Initial Phase1–4 WeeksReduction in acute bone marrow stress
Intermediate Phase1–3 MonthsGradual decline in average cell size
Normalization Phase3–6 MonthsStabilization of MCV within healthy range
Maintenance Phase6+ MonthsFull restoration of healthy blood profile

When to Seek Medical Intervention for Enlarged Blood Cells

Usually, red blood cells get back to normal with time and good nutrition. But, watch for signs that your body isn’t healing as it should. If your blood counts don’t get better after months of sobriety, see a specialist.

If you have concerning symptoms, talk to your doctor:

  • Persistent fatigue or weakness that doesn’t go away.
  • Shortness of breath when doing everyday activities.
  • Unusual bruising or slow-healing wounds.
  • Dizziness or feeling lightheaded that affects your daily life.

Early intervention is vital for managing ongoing blood issues. Your doctor can figure out if other health problems are causing macrocytosis. Remember, seeking help is a sign of strength and dedication to your health.
